Steroid addiction of Jeremy Jackson

Jeremy Jackson played Hobie Buchanon, the son of David Hasselhof, in the television series Baywatch. He turned to anabolic steroids and HGH to overcome addiction to methamphetamine.
This actor did it because he was told to go info sports to escape from addiction to meth but now he fears for his life. He became addicted to the gym and HGH and the steroid testosterone. This actor can’t stop taking these medications.
This actor decided to join the cast of Celebrity Rehab with the doctor Drew Pinsky for Season 5. But unemployed actors should be defined having drug addiction to appear on Celebrity Rehab. What does Celebrity Rehab represent actually? It is the first TV series about real experiences of celebrities that want to change their lives, to escape from addiction to alcohol and drugs. So, they join Celebrity Rehab to have a special treatment. All these individuals have a real decision to reach the recovery.
The chief specialist is Drew Pinsky there. He is known better as Dr. Drew. He is a radio and television personality. This expert hosted the talk show LOVELINE.
It is known that Jeremy Jackson doesn’t use methamphetamine since 2000. He doesn’t have this addiction. Then, he has joined Celebrity Rehab to treat his steroid addiction.
Earlier the expert Drew Pinsky noted in an interview that he knew many things about steroids. He said that when he was 20 years old, he was in the world of bodybuilders. Those who used steroids told him about many aspects because he was involved in medicine. They told him such aspects that were not said to others. Dr. Drew noticed that several athletes began to administrate steroids just because anybody gave them a pill. They attempted to administrate it and became addicted to steroids step by step. Now they are dying from the addiction. They have depression, aggressive behavior, mania and physical problems. They have cut duration of their lives by 10-20 years. They have chosen this way themselves.
Nonetheless, it is necessary to note that although it is widely discussed about steroid addiction and dependency, this condition doesn’t have any scientific basis. The American Psychological Association has not yet proved it. One offers to change the methods. So, further researches are required in this field.
